    initial setup system operation Step 3 ... system start up Power On/Off To power the system On/Off, connect the power cable to the DC 12V port on the rear panel. Flip the toggle switch on in the back of the DVR. At startup, the system performs a basic system check and runs an initial loading sequence.

    initial setup Basic operation Motion Detect Setup You can configure motion detection for each channel (Camera) connected to the DVR. To configure motion detection: From the Main Menu click ADVANCED. Then click MD (Motion Detect). Under STATUS, select ON to enable motion detection for the desired chan- nel.
